My name is Natalia, and I am 30 years old. I have a wonderful husband and a beautiful daughter.
I am responsible for our ministry to orphaned children and foster families (children who previously lived in our children’s home, “Daddy’s Home”). I also serve as the leader of the Preteens Ministry for children aged 8 to 14 and oversee the mission’s finances.

I became part of the mission in 2017 when I came to Kenya on a short-term mission trip that was supposed to last only three months. However, God had different plans. Since then, Kenya has become the place of my ministry, and the mission has become my extended family.
Back in Ukraine, one of my main ministries was working with teenagers. That is why children of this age group have always held a special place in my heart. In 2020, I began serving preteens here in Kenya as well. Today, we have an amazing team of Kenyan leaders who help us in this ministry.

Every week, around 200 preteens attend our program, and I am truly grateful to be part of what God is doing in their lives.
When I first arrived in Kenya, I served in our school, helping with Bible lessons, games, crafts, drawing activities, relay races, dancing, and health education classes. Outside of school hours, I spent my time with the children from our children’s home.
As I got to know them, I could see the pain behind many of their smiles. Although they often appeared happy, many carried deep wounds in their hearts.
In some ways, I understood their pain. My father left our family when I was six years old, and for several years I was separated from my mother. Because of this, I knew how much these children needed love, acceptance, encouragement, and genuine care. Most importantly, I knew they needed to know Jesus.

I wanted to share that love with them.

Over time, I realized that I could not leave. I had fallen in love with these children. They became part of my life, and they will always hold a special place in my heart.

That’s why when people ask me how many children I have,

I tell them I am a happy mother of 30!
